Archive Retrieval Configurator 
Use
The ARC allows you to create and configure information structures that are required by the Archive Information System (AS) to execute archive searches.

With this, you can activate an available information structure so that during a subsequent archiving program delete phase of the archiving object it automatically fills with data from the archive. For more information, see
Activating Information StructuresFill Information Structures
This function allows you to fill an information structure with data from the available archives if the delete program has already processed those archives. Normally this is not necessary because activated information structures are filled automatically during the archiving program delete run For more information, see
